Abstract
Overview
ISO/IEC 23000-19:2024/Amd 2:2026 is an amendment to the MPEG-A Part 19 Common Media Application Format (CMAF), which is a widely adopted media container standard for segmented media delivery. This amendment introduces an additional structural CMAF brand profile, enhancing support for new track types and media profiles within the CMAF specification. The CMAF framework enables efficient streaming, editing, and packaging of multimedia content across a variety of platforms, ensuring interoperability and adaptive bitrate delivery for video, audio, and metadata.
Key Topics
- CMAF Brand Profiles: Introduction and definition of new structural CMAF brands such as
cmf1, which extends and restricts existing brands and explicitly allows carrying supplementary metadata tracks within the same media track as the primary audio, video, or audiovisual content. - Track Structure Enhancements: Clarification and expansion of what constitutes a primary media track (carrying essential audio or video data) and the addition of supplementary metadata tracks for carrying related metadata, with strict associations to primary tracks.
- Media Track Types and Extensions: Support for new file extensions and internet media types for media, subtitles, and metadata, such as .cmfv for video and .cmfm for metadata.
- Multiview and Alpha Video Support: Specification of new media profiles for multi-view HEVC (MV-HEVC) content, including stereo video, alpha channel (opacity information), and stereo with alpha, supporting advanced features like stereoscopic video and transparency.
- Metadata Handling: Differentiation between timed metadata tracks (independent metadata streams) and supplementary metadata tracks (metadata tied directly to primary content), ensuring precise metadata application and seamless adaptive streaming.
Applications
Implementing the updates from this amendment into CMAF-based workflows brings multiple practical benefits and use cases:
- Advanced Streaming Services: Enables enhanced streaming scenarios such as 3D video (stereoscopic), video with transparency, and richer supplemental information for user experiences, making it ideal for immersive applications and interactive media.
- Content Packaging and Interoperability: Streamlines the creation and exchange of segmented media files compatible with a wide range of playback environments, content delivery networks, and digital rights management systems.
- Broadcast and OTT Platforms: Supports broadcasters and over-the-top (OTT) streaming providers in delivering segmented content that adapts seamlessly to varying network conditions and device capabilities, including support for stereo and multi-view video content.
- Metadata-Driven Experiences: Provides tools for synchronizing supplementary metadata (such as captions, timed program information, or geolocation data) with primary media, which is essential for accessibility, analytics, and enhanced presentation.
- Flexible Media Distribution: The improved structure and defined profiles ease the implementation of adaptive bitrate streaming, content personalization, and future-proofing against evolving codec standards.
Related Standards
- ISO/IEC 23000 (MPEG-A): The overarching series for multimedia application formats.
- ISO Base Media File Format (ISOBMFF) [ISO/IEC 14496-12]: The underlying container format upon which CMAF and its tracks are built.
- HEVC (High Efficiency Video Coding) [ISO/IEC 23008-2]: Video coding standard supported natively in CMAF, including multiview and auxiliary data profiles.
- IETF RFC 6381: Provides media type and codec parameter definitions for media streaming profiles.
- MPEG-DASH: Often used alongside CMAF for adaptive streaming delivery.
- Other CMAF Amendments: Updates for codec-specific and media profile constraints, such as LCEVC and MV-HEVC enhancements, ensure conformance and compatibility.
